> If that is the case (can simulate 3550 on 72xx simulator), is there still
> need to buy all expensive LAB equipment?????????

Not really. The 7200 router virtualizer (not really a simulator) is
incrediably flexiable. I've used it to set up full MPLS toplogies with
10 routers among other things. It's really an amazing tool.

You can even map ports to real ethernet ports so you can connect the
virtualized lab to real network devices. So at worst case, you may
need to buy a couple of 3550's and a few extra NIC's for your PC to
build a full a lab...
